Group Safety and Compliance Manager
Join the Global Leader in Aesthetic Treatments – Lead Safety and Compliance Across Australia and other International Markets
Laser Clinics Group is seeking an experienced Group Safety and Compliance Manager to work across our Medical, Safety, Legal and Risk & Compliance Teams, based at our North Sydney Support Office. This is a key organisational role that will oversee the group-wide work health and safety and compliance framework and embed a culture of safety, compliance and integrity across our clinic network in Australia, New Zealand, the UK, and Canada.
If you’re a safety or compliance professional with expertise across multi-jurisdictional environments, and you’re ready to make an impact in a high-growth global business, this could be the role for you.
What You’ll Do
Lead Global Safety and Compliance Framework
Implement, and maintain a global safety compliance program partnering with our legal, medical and operational teams to meet Group and local market requirements.
Monitor regulatory developments and proactively manage compliance risks across multiple markets.
Embed Compliance Culture Across the Group
Design and deliver safety and operational compliance training, policies, and awareness programs.
Conduct risk assessments, internal audits, and thematic reviews to evaluate control effectiveness.
Drive Continuous Improvement
Oversee and evolve into best practice incident reporting, breach management, and remediation processes.
Partner with Legal, Risk, HR, Clinical, and Operations teams to ensure compliance is embedded into business-as-usual practices.
Lead, or contribute to, Investigations and manage various claims (Insurance, WHS, HR) from time to time
We’d Feel WOW if You Have:
8+ years’ experience in safety, compliance, risk, legal, or regulatory roles
Demonstrate a practical knowledge of safety, compliance and regulatory frameworks across Australia. Exposure to other countries regulatory environments, such as New Zealand, the UK or Canada Is highly regarded
Exposure to health, franchising, privacy, or medical/cosmetic regulatory frameworks Is also highly regarded
Proven success in designing and embedding safety compliance programs in complex, multi-site or franchise environments
Tertiary qualifications in law, business, commerce, compliance, or a related field (industry certifications such as GRCI, IIA, ACAMS highly regarded)
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ills, with the ability to influence at senior levels
